  • Distillation Process: Unlike most traditional tequilas, Corzo undergoes a triple-distillation cycle over a 56-hour period. The producers utilize an extensive "heart-of-hearts" cutting process, extracting only the ultra-pure center cuts. This meticulous method requires roughly twice the amount of blue agave typically used by other standard brands. 
  • Double-Aging Technique: It is matured using a distinctive process that inserts a third distillation between two separate oak barrel aging windows. This balances agave flavor with barrel extraction, resting the spirit in both American white oak and French oak barrels. 
  • Origin: Produced at Tequila Cazadores De Arandas (NOM 1487) in the Los Altos region of Jalisco, the brand operates as part of the Bacardi premium spirits portfolio. 
Tasting Profile
  • Appearance: Radiant, golden amber hue with warm reflections.
  • Aroma: Creamy vanilla custard, baked pears, honey, and subtle floral tones accompanied by a warm oak backdrop.
  • Palate: Velvety and rich with central notes of toasted vanilla, dark chocolate, toffee, and warm honey.
  • Finish: Extremely smooth, long, and elegant, ending with a sophisticated, light wisp of smoke and lingering baking spice.
  • Alcohol by Volume (ABV): 40% (80 Proof). 
Best Serving Methods
  • Neat or On the Rocks: Due to its extensive aging and triple-distillation refinement, it is best enjoyed as a slow-sipping spirit to fully appreciate its complex layers. 
  • Premium Cocktails: It can be used to elevate spirit-forward drinks like a classic Añejo Old Fashioned, where its oaky sweetness complements the bitters
